Add an incline to the treadmill workout and you'll boost the challenge. You'll also be able to target various muscle groups that are harder to reach while running flat or walking. It keeps you active and avoids the dreaded treadmill plateau. If you're new to incline-walking, start with a low amount like 10 percent and gradually increase it to avoid injury.

Choose compact treadmills with slopes of up to 12 percent. They should also include the ability to decline, which lets experienced runners experience running downhill. Be aware of the speed that is the highest as well as the weight capacity. These features will help you choose the best model to match your fitness goals.

If you're looking for an at-home treadmill to train for a marathon, or to add some variety to their power-walking and walking sessions A compact treadmill with an incline can offer some serious benefits. With a smaller footprint, these machines are much easier to move away from the way when not in use, or tucked away under a desk, and they typically come with a selection of pre-programmed workouts created by professional trainers.

Once you've decided what you want, choosing the right treadmill becomes simple. For instance, if you intend to run on your new treadmill, it is best to choose one with a belt deck that's at least 55 inches in length. This will ensure that you're able to maximize your stride length while running, rather than having to adjust your speed to match the machine. If you're planning to incorporate running exercises that include sprints in your routine, then you'll require a treadmill that is able to handle this increased stress.

Many treadmills with compact designs have an incline feature that simulates running or walking up the hill. This helps tone muscles like the glutes, which are usually overlooked during flat training sessions. This is an excellent method of mixing your workouts and it's also a good idea for those who struggle with mobility issues, since it can help them feel less restricted in their ability to finish the jog or walk.
